Marlin G. Stutzman

Marlin Gene Stutzman, age 82, of 200 Fountain Road, Hegins, passed away Thursday, October 16, 2008 at Waterbridge at Pine Grove Personal Care Home, Pine Grove.

He was born on Tuesday, August 17, 1926 in Hegins Twp, a son of the late Orville E Stutzman and the late Estella M (Kroh) Stutzman.

He was a 1944 graduate of the former Hegins Twp High School.

He was a self employed farmer.

He was a member of Friedens United Church of Christ, Hegins.

He was also a member of member of F&AM Valley Lodge 797, Valley View and the Harrisburg Consistory..

He was preceded in death by his wife, Jean M Stutzman in 1997, by a son Glenn M Stutzman in 2002, and by a sister Iva Ebert.

He is survived by a daughter, Molly J Otto and her husband, Clint of Hegins; two granddaughters, Kristi K Clark and her husband, Steve of Camp Hill and Marsha J Begis and her husband, Mike of Mt Carmel; a grandson, Ian G Stutzman of Hegins; a great granddaughter, Hailey N Clark of Camp Hill; two great grandsons, Mason R Begis and Mitchell J Begis both of Mt. Carmel; a daughter in law, Colleen B Stutzman of Hegins; and a companion, Orpah Umholtz of Valley View.

Private services will be held at the convenience of the family

Memorial contributions can be made to the American Cancer Society.

Buffington-Reed Funeral Home, Valley View, is in charge of arrangements.
